Calculation > Work schedule

The Work schedule defines which hours, days, and holidays are considered working time. It is used across the application to calculate metrics that depend on working hours.

You can configure the work schedule from:

The work schedule is global. Any change made in one chart will automatically apply to all charts in the app.

Configurable options

You can customize:

  • Time zone

  • Work days - for example, from Monday to Friday

  • Work hours - for example, from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M.

  • Breaks – add one or multiple breaks (lunch or maintenance breaks).

  • Holidays – exclude specific days from calculations. You can also make them repeat annually.

  • 24 hours per day – enable this option if your team works around the clock (disables specific work hours and breaks).

Example

If your work schedule defines Monday–Friday, 9:00 AM–6:00 PM with a 1-hour break, then:

  • An issue that started Monday at 9:00 AM and was completed Tuesday at 9:00 AM will count as 8 hours or 1 day.

  • An issue that started Friday, 4:00 PM, and was completed Monday, 10:00 AM, will count as 3 hours (2 on Friday, 1 on Monday).

  • Holidays and weekends will be skipped in all calculations.
